Stiff neck and sore shoulders can be caused by poor posture or due to cervical spondylosis. Relief modalities include physical therapy and medication, etc. 1. Bad posture: long-term bad posture may cause fatigue compensation of the soft tissues of the neck and shoulder with symptoms of pain and stiffness; patients first need to correct the wrong posture; secondly, they can wear a cervical brace to relieve the pressure on the cervical vertebrae. Can also be hot compresses, massage, infrared and other physical therapy to accelerate the blood flow of the soft tissues of the neck and shoulder, to relieve the fatigue of the soft tissues. 2. Cervical spondylosis: Cervical spondylosis on the one hand may cause tension and spasm of the soft tissues of the neck and shoulder. On the other hand, it may cause compression of the nerves and stiffness of the cervical spine and shoulder pain symptoms, patients in the hot compresses and physical therapy at the same time, but also medication, such as oral ibuprofen, meloxicam and other drugs, anti-inflammatory and pain relief. Oral medication such as eperisone hydrochloride to relieve soft tissue tension. The same disease, the patient’s physical condition is different, different stages of the disease, the treatment method is different, should be standardized under the guidance of the doctor.
